Increased Chances of Electrocution
Trying to fix wiring yourself puts you in direct contact with live wires far more than you might think. People untrained in electrical safety can easily mix up hot, neutral, or ground wires, or they might not even realize a wire is energized. All it takes is one small mistake, and you could be in a world of pain—or worse. Only a local electrician near me shows up with the right gear to safely check circuits before any hands-on work starts. Miss that step, and you could expose yourself to severe shock, burns, or even death.
Potential for Electrical Fires
Electrical fires don’t look dramatic at first, but faulty wire splices, poorly chosen outlets, or overloaded circuits all create invisible tinder. You might think the lights are working fine or that your DIY job did the trick, only to find out weeks later that heat from a hidden bad connection has been quietly building up. The scary part? DIY electrical work is a leading cause of residential electrical fires. Hiring a local electrician near me means circuits get tested, proper parts are used, and connections are triple-checked—making fires much less likely.

Up-To-Date with Changing Regulations
Electrical codes aren’t static; they’re updated every few years to reflect better safety practices or new technology. Keeping current means checking recent changes and understanding both national rules and any local tweaks. A licensed electrician near me does this regularly as part of their job.
Blockquote:
Only a pro who follows code updates knows about new requirements—like extra GFCI protection or rules covering home offices and EV chargers. Homeowners shouldn’t have to keep up with every change; that’s a job for a licensed electrician near me.
Proper Permits and Documentation
Permits aren’t just paperwork—they’re proof your electrical work passed both planning and inspection. Pulling a permit means the project gets checked by an expert before it’s approved. This keeps your insurance valid, protects your investment, and gives you documentation if you need to prove everything meets standard later.
If you’re planning:
- A major renovation
- Panel or service upgrades
- Installing new circuits or heavy appliances
You’ll need a permit and inspection, often required by your city or municipality. Skipping this step? You’re gambling with your home’s safety and value.

Knowledge of Modern and Older Electrical Systems
Homes built decades apart have their quirks, especially when it comes to wiring style and capacity. The best electrician near me understands what to expect in both new builds and vintage homes. Aluminum wiring? Knob and tube? Arc-fault protection? They’ve seen it all.
This wide-ranging experience helps prevent mistakes during repairs or upgrades—mistakes that could lead to bigger problems down the road. With an expert, those differences are never a surprise.

Insurance Requirements and Coverage
There’s also the matter of insurance. Many homeowners don’t realize that most home insurance policies require electrical work to be done by a licensed professional. If a DIY job goes wrong, your insurer might refuse to cover the damages. A professional local electrician near me comes with the right certifications, and their work is insured—giving homeowners one less thing to stress over if something ever does go sideways.

Benefits of Professional Tools and Technology
Advanced Diagnostic Equipment
Modern electrical systems aren’t always easy to figure out by sight alone. That’s where the benefits of professional tools and technology really stand out. Electricians roll in with specialized gear—think digital multimeters, infrared cameras, and circuit analyzers. This equipment catches hidden issues like overheating wires or faulty breakers, which would fly under the radar with basic tools found in most garages. So while a homeowner might guess, professionals know exactly what’s wrong.
